DLL files (Dynamic Link Libraries) are shared core modules used by Windows programs to run efficiently without duplicating code. Most errors occur because the DLL is missing, corrupted, or outdated. In many cases, reinstalling the related application, repairing Windows, or replacing the DLL resolves the issue.

Windows System Fix

Make sure Windows is fully updated. To repair system files automatically, right-click the Start menu, open PowerShell (Admin), and run these two commands in order:

Step A D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th
Step B sfc /scannow

How do I register DLL files?

Most DLL files do not need registration. However, if your file is a COM component and requires explicit system registration, follow these steps:

1

Open Terminal

Right-click the Start menu and open PowerShell (Admin) or Command Prompt (Admin).

2

Run Command

Type the command below for your file type and press Enter. You can drag and drop the DLL file directly into the terminal window to fill its path automatically.

64-bit regsvr32 "C:\path\to\filename.dll"
32-bit C:\Windows\SysWOW64\regsvr32 "C:\path\to\filename.dll"
